Warehouse Supervisor

At Wisk, we're transforming the future of urban mobility through safe, all-electric, autonomous flight. We are a passionate team working together toward a sustainable future, solving high-impact problems that have never been solved before. By delivering everyday flight for everyone, we're making it possible to spend less time getting there and more time being there. If you want to be part of shaping the future of mobility, then read on!


We are looking for a Warehouse Supervisor to join our team. The goal of the Warehouse Supervisor at Wisk is to lead and enhance the operational performance of our warehouse to support our development of next-generation aircraft. You will be part of the Supply Chain team, responsible for streamlining warehouse processes, ensuring regulatory compliance, and optimizing inventory management systems.


Due to the nature of the work required for this position, this is an onsite opportunity. You will be required to work from our Mountain View office.


In this role you will:
  • Lead day-to-day warehouse operations, including receiving, kitting, stocking, cycle counting, and inventory management, ensuring accuracy and compliance with aviation regulations.
  • Develop and implement warehouse strategies and processes to support lean production and operational excellence.
  • Manage and mentor a team of warehouse associates, driving performance and fostering a culture of accountability and continuous improvement.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including manufacturing, quality, production planning, and facilities to ensure seamless integration of warehouse operations into broader organizational goals.
  • Drive initiatives to optimize inventory accuracy, reduce cycle times, and improve overall operational efficiency.
  • Develop and maintain KPIs for warehouse operations, ensuring performance aligns with company objectives and identifying areas for improvement.
  • Ensure compliance with hazardous material handling (e.g., lithium-ion batteries), and all state and federal requirements for shipping and receiving aircraft parts.
  • Implement and oversee training programs, operational guides, and SOPs to maintain a high-performing and compliant warehouse environment.


Requirements:
  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ience with at least 8 years of progressive experience in warehouse operations, preferably in aerospace or automotive industries.
  • Proven leadership experience managing warehouse teams and driving operational excellence.
  • Deep understanding of inventory management systems, shipping/receiving best practices, and aviation logistics regulations.
  • Hands-on experience in hazardous materials handling, international shipping, and logistics compliance.
  • Strong anal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ills, with the ability to prioritize and manage mult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ment.
  • Proficiency in ERP and WMS systems, with experience in data-driven decision-making to optimize processes.
  • Excellent communication skills, with the ability to work effectively across all levels of the organization and with external providers.
  • Proven track record of process creation, implementation, and documentation
  • Customer service attitude - Getting stuff done (the right way)


Desired:
  • Certification in supply chain, logistics, or related fields (e.g., APICS, CLTD).
  • Theoretical knowledge or practical experience with SixSigma, Lean, 5S concepts
  • Experience with continuous improvement initiatives
  • Experience with setting up new warehouse locations
